Re: Anyone familar with Hinckley Yachts
My father had a Hinckley for years. Best boat he ever owned. The company is very good to work with and their Satellite yard in Southwest Habor (or was it Bar Harbor) is very good. The quality of the work is unreal. The quality of the boats is top notch. The crew of people that work there are great. They are TRUE Mainers. My father complained that he could not hear the low oil preasure alarm. As a joke they put a old school bell in the boat. When my father and I went down and started the boat they all hid around the corner. We about jumped overboard when we started it. Funny thing is we actually kept it in there. Had to have a cut off switch for when we left habors in the am it was that loud!!! I have been on a few of the boats that you are looking at. If that is the type of boat that you want you WILL be happy.
